When I read, I'm bad at keeping all the details in my mind, so ive been trying to take more notes!


I generally have a page of static information with major sections such as:

  • Places (Continents / Clans)
  • People (Main characters / relations)
  • Items (Important things)
  • Glossary (Fictional words)

I also keep a section for quotes that I enjoy or stuck out to me (or chapter reference, if it's just a whole good chapter)

I keep a spare blank page to use as a "scratch buffer" while I read, so if a character or thing is too insignificant / boring to include in my main overview of notes, I can omit it.

And lastly, I try to do one-line summaries per chapter, just so I know I'm not TOO lost as to what the heck is going on.

Sometimes I take notes on my phone, sometimes in a coilbound lined notebook.
